Benefits of Advanced Dental Practice Software
Adopting advanced dental practice software offers numerous benefits that can revolutionize how dental clinics operate. Here are some key advantages:
- Enhanced Patient Management: With comprehensive patient management features, dental practices can efficiently handle appointments, follow-ups, and patient records. This leads to reduced wait times and improved patient experiences.

- Improved Communication: Integrated communication tools facilitate better interaction between staff and patients, ensuring clarity and reducing the chances of misunderstandings.
- Data Security: Advanced software solutions prioritize data protection, ensuring that patient information is securely stored and easily accessible by authorized personnel.
- Analytics and Reporting: Real-time analytics provide valuable insights into practice performance, aiding in data-driven decision-making and strategic planning.
Key Features to Look for in Dental Practice Software
Choosing the right software requires understanding the features that will most benefit your practice. Here are critical features to consider:
Comprehensive Scheduling

Patient Portal Access
A patient portal empowers patients by allowing them to access their health records, schedule appointments, and communicate with dental staff at their convenience. This feature enhances patient engagement and satisfaction.
Integration Capabilities

Billing and Insurance Processing
Automated billing and insurance claim management reduces administrative burdens and improves cash flow. Look for software that simplifies these processes and reduces errors.
Implementing Dental Software: Best Practices
Successfully implementing new software requires careful planning and execution. Consider these best practices:
- Evaluate Your Needs: Assess the specific needs of your practice to select software that aligns with your goals.
- Training and Support: Ensure your team receives comprehensive training on the new system. Continuous support is vital for long-term success.

- Feedback Loop: Encourage feedback from staff and patients to identify areas for improvement and ensure the software meets their needs.
